10 Must-Read Tech Books Of 2025

Bookshelf: The Future of Artificial Intelligence

Must-Reads for Navigating the AI-Driven World

The past year was a transformative one in technology, dominated by advancements in artificial intelligence. From the proliferation of new generative AI applications and the rise of AI agents to questions about technology governance and the future of work, the following books offer essential perspectives from industry pioneers, leading academics, and veteran tech journalists, helping readers navigate an increasingly AI-driven world.

Co-Intelligence: Living and Working with AI

Wharton professor and “One Useful Thing” newsletter author Ethan Mollick provides guidance to help individuals thrive in the age of AI. He examines how to effectively partner with AI as a co-worker, co-teacher, and coach while offering practical insights for preserving human identity and creating positive outcomes in this new era of human-AI collaboration.

Supremacy: AI, ChatGPT, and the Race that Will Change the World

In this Financial Times and Schroders Business Book of the Year Award winner, Bloomberg technology writer Parmy Olson provides an insider’s look at the high-stakes competition between OpenAI and DeepMind, revealing the complex dynamics shaping AI’s future. Through exclusive access to industry sources, she examines the rivalries, ethical challenges, and potential threats that emerge when AI development is driven by powerful tech companies and CEOs.

Nexus: A Brief History of Information Networks from the Stone Age to AI

Nexus, by Yuval Noah Harari, examines humanity’s fraught relationship with information, tracing its influence from the Stone Age to the modern era of AI. Through historical milestones like religious canonization, witch-hunts, and totalitarian regimes, Harari unpacks how societies have wielded information as both a tool for progress and a weapon of control. As we confront ecological collapse, rampant misinformation, and the rise of artificial intelligence, the book challenges us to rethink the balance between truth, wisdom, and power, offering a hopeful perspective and calling for rediscovering our shared humanity amid the complex interplay of information and existential threat.

The Corporate Life Cycle: Business, Investment, and Management Implications

NYU professor and valuation expert Aswath Damodaran presents a universal framework for understanding how companies evolve through different stages of the corporate lifecycle. His work helps readers recognize crucial transition points in corporate finance and adjust their strategies accordingly, offering vital insights for optimizing management and investment decisions. He also explores the tactics and tradeoffs companies face as they leverage technology, acquired or homegrown, to scale up quickly.

Burn Book: A Tech Love Story

Veteran tech journalist Kara Swisher delivers an insider’s chronicle of Silicon Valley’s most influential figures. Drawing from three decades of interviews with leaders like Steve Jobs, Jeff Bezos, and Mark Zuckerberg, she provides a candid look at how tech visionaries have both contributed to and hindered progress in the digital age.

All Hands on Tech: The AI-Powered Citizen Revolution

This book explores the transformative power of citizen developers—business domain experts leveraging democratized technology to drive innovation. Through compelling case studies, the authors reveal how empowering employees to create applications, automations, and analytics enhances organizational agility and minimizes IT bottlenecks. The book provides a practical framework for integrating citizen development into digital strategies while aligning with corporate goals and mitigating risks. A must-read for leaders and innovators, it redefines the future of work, showcasing how technology can unlock the ingenuity of all employees for a more innovative and efficient enterprise.

AI Snake Oil: What Artificial Intelligence Can Do, What It Can’t, and How to Tell the Difference

Computer scientists Arvind Narayanan and Sayash Kapoor cut through AI hype and misinformation to provide a clear understanding of AI’s true capabilities and limitations. They examine AI’s impact across areas like education, medicine, hiring, and criminal justice, helping readers understand potential risks and make informed decisions about AI adoption in both professional and personal contexts.

The Singularity Is Nearer: When We Merge with AI

A renowned futurist, Kurzweil returns with a fresh perspective on technological advancement, examining his earlier predictions and exploring how exponential growth in AI and biotechnology will transform human life. He tackles controversial topics from job automation to life extension, offering both optimistic visions and consideration of potential perils.

The Nvidia Way: Jensen Huang and the Making of a Tech Giant

This business history book reveals how Nvidia transformed from a gaming-focused startup to a powerhouse driving the AI revolution. Drawing from more than 100 interviews, including conversations with CEO Jensen Huang and his cofounders, Kim uncovers the company’s unique culture and strategic decisions that enabled Nvidia to outmaneuver tech giants and position itself at the forefront of the AI era.

The AI-Savvy Leader: Nine Ways to Take Back Control and Make AI Work

De Cremer’s book is a compelling guide for leaders to take charge of AI transformation in their organizations. It highlights how many leaders have abdicated their roles, risking organizational failure in navigating the complexities of human-machine collaboration. Focusing on nine actionable steps rooted in core leadership skills like vision-setting, communication, and strategic execution, the book equips leaders to integrate AI responsibly and effectively. Rather than delving into technical AI details, it emphasizes the need for visionary leadership to align AI initiatives with organizational goals for sustainable growth and success.

Industry-Specific Solutions

With the rise of hybrid and remote work, tools for hybrid and remote work have become essential for businesses to thrive. In today’s fast-paced world, companies need tailored solutions to stay ahead of the competition. Industry-specific solutions cater to the unique needs of each sector, providing a competitive edge.

Main Benefits of Industry-Specific Solutions

Industry-specific solutions offer numerous benefits, including increased efficiency, improved customer satisfaction, and enhanced data security. By leveraging these solutions, businesses can streamline their operations, reduce costs, and improve their bottom line.

Increased Efficiency

Industry-specific solutions automate tasks, freeing up staff to focus on high-value activities. This leads to increased productivity, reduced errors, and faster turnaround times. For instance, in the healthcare sector, electronic health records (EHRs) have improved patient care and reduced administrative burdens.

Improved Customer Satisfaction

Tailored solutions enable businesses to provide personalized experiences, leading to higher customer satisfaction rates. In the retail industry, for example, loyalty programs and personalized marketing campaigns have become essential for building strong customer relationships.

Enhanced Data Security

Industry-specific solutions often include robust security measures, protecting sensitive data from cyber threats. In the financial sector, for instance, secure online payment systems and encryption technologies have become crucial for safeguarding customer information.

Industry-Specific Solutions for Key Sectors

Different industries have unique requirements, and tailored solutions can address these needs.

Healthcare

In the healthcare sector, industry-specific solutions include EHRs, telemedicine platforms, and medical billing software. These solutions improve patient care, streamline clinical workflows, and reduce administrative costs.

Retail

In the retail industry, solutions like inventory management systems, point-of-sale software, and e-commerce platforms have become essential. These solutions help retailers manage their supply chains, optimize pricing, and provide seamless customer experiences.

Financial Services

In the financial sector, industry-specific solutions include online banking platforms, investment management software, and risk management tools. These solutions enable financial institutions to provide secure, efficient, and personalized services to their customers.

Implementing Industry-Specific Solutions

Implementing tailored solutions requires careful planning, execution, and ongoing support.

Assessing Business Needs

The first step in implementing industry-specific solutions is to assess business needs and identify areas for improvement. This involves analyzing current workflows, identifying pain points, and determining the required functionality.

Selecting the Right Solution

Once business needs have been assessed, the next step is to select the right solution. This involves evaluating different vendors, comparing features and pricing, and reading reviews from other customers.

Training and Support

After implementing a tailored solution, it is essential to provide training and support to staff. This ensures a smooth transition, minimizes disruption, and maximizes the benefits of the new solution.

Challenges and Limitations

While industry-specific solutions offer numerous benefits, there are also challenges and limitations to consider.

High Costs

One of the main challenges is the high cost of implementing and maintaining tailored solutions. This can be a barrier for small and medium-sized businesses with limited budgets.

Complexity

Another challenge is the complexity of implementing and integrating industry-specific solutions. This requires significant technical expertise and can be time-consuming.

Scalability

Finally, there is the challenge of scalability. As businesses grow, their solutions must also scale to meet increasing demands. This requires flexible and adaptable solutions that can evolve with the business.

Future of Industry-Specific Solutions

The future of industry-specific solutions is exciting, with emerging technologies like artificial intelligence, blockchain, and the Internet of Things (IoT) set to transform various sectors.

Artificial Intelligence

AI will play a significant role in enhancing industry-specific solutions, enabling businesses to automate tasks, predict customer behavior, and make data-driven decisions.

Blockchain

Blockchain technology will provide secure, transparent, and tamper-proof solutions for industries like finance, healthcare, and supply chain management.

Internet of Things (IoT)

The IoT will connect devices, sensors, and systems, enabling real-time monitoring, automation, and optimization of business processes.

Digital Transformation in Healthcare: Strategies for Improving Patient Outcomes

With digital transformation strategies, healthcare organizations can revolutionize the way they deliver care, improving patient outcomes and enhancing the overall healthcare experience. By leveraging technology, healthcare providers can streamline clinical workflows, enhance patient engagement, and make data-driven decisions. In this article, we will explore the various digital transformation strategies that can be employed in healthcare to improve patient outcomes.

Introduction to Digital Transformation in Healthcare

Digital transformation in healthcare refers to the integration of digital technology into all areas of healthcare, from patient engagement to clinical decision-making. This transformation has the potential to improve patient outcomes, reduce healthcare costs, and enhance the overall quality of care. With the increasing demand for high-quality, patient-centered care, healthcare organizations are under pressure to adopt digital transformation strategies that can help them stay ahead of the curve.

Benefits of Digital Transformation in Healthcare

The benefits of digital transformation in healthcare are numerous. Some of the key benefits include improved patient outcomes, enhanced patient engagement, and increased efficiency. Digital transformation can also help healthcare organizations to reduce costs, improve care coordination, and enhance the overall quality of care. Additionally, digital transformation can enable healthcare organizations to make data-driven decisions, which can lead to better patient outcomes and improved population health.

Digital Transformation Strategies for Improving Patient Outcomes

There are several digital transformation strategies that healthcare organizations can employ to improve patient outcomes. Some of these strategies include telemedicine, artificial intelligence, and data analytics. Telemedicine, for example, can enable healthcare providers to remotely monitor patients, reducing the need for hospitalizations and improving patient outcomes. Artificial intelligence can help healthcare providers to analyze large amounts of data, identifying patterns and trends that can inform clinical decision-making.

Telemedicine: A Key Digital Transformation Strategy

Telemedicine is a digital transformation strategy that enables healthcare providers to remotely deliver care to patients. This can include video consultations, remote monitoring, and mobile health applications. Telemedicine has the potential to improve patient outcomes by increasing access to care, reducing hospitalizations, and enhancing patient engagement. Additionally, telemedicine can help healthcare organizations to reduce costs, improve care coordination, and enhance the overall quality of care.

Artificial Intelligence: Enhancing Clinical Decision-Making

Artificial intelligence is a digital transformation strategy that can help healthcare providers to analyze large amounts of data, identifying patterns and trends that can inform clinical decision-making. Artificial intelligence can be used to analyze medical images, diagnose diseases, and develop personalized treatment plans. Additionally, artificial intelligence can help healthcare providers to predict patient outcomes, identify high-risk patients, and develop targeted interventions.

Implementing Digital Transformation Strategies

Implementing digital transformation strategies in healthcare requires a thoughtful and multi-step approach. Healthcare organizations must first assess their current technology infrastructure, identifying areas for improvement and opportunities for growth. They must then develop a digital transformation strategy, which outlines their goals, objectives, and key performance indicators. Additionally, healthcare organizations must ensure that they have the necessary resources and support in place to implement their digital transformation strategy.

Change Management: A Critical Component of Digital Transformation

Change management is a critical component of digital transformation in healthcare. Healthcare organizations must ensure that they have a clear change management strategy in place, which outlines their approach to communicating change, training staff, and addressing resistance. This can include providing training and support to staff, communicating the benefits of digital transformation, and addressing concerns and resistance.

Overcoming Barriers to Digital Transformation

There are several barriers to digital transformation in healthcare, including regulatory barriers, financial barriers, and cultural barriers. Regulatory barriers, for example, can include concerns about data privacy and security, while financial barriers can include the high cost of implementing digital transformation strategies. Cultural barriers, on the other hand, can include resistance to change and a lack of digital literacy among staff.

Addressing Regulatory Barriers to Digital Transformation

Regulatory barriers to digital transformation in healthcare can be addressed by ensuring that healthcare organizations are compliant with relevant regulations, such as the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act (HIPAA). This can include implementing robust data security measures, ensuring that staff are trained on data privacy and security, and conducting regular audits and risk assessments.
